Glycoprotein IIb/IIIa Inhibitors in Acute Myocardial Infarction and Angiographic Microvascular Obstruction: The REVERSE-FLOW Trial.

Ingo EitelRoza SaraeiDominik JurczykAndreas FachRainer HambrechtHarm WienbergenChristian FrerkerTobias SchmidtAbdelhakim AllaliAlexander JoostChristoph MarquetandThomas KurzPhilip HaafGregor FahrniChristian E MuellerSteffen DeschHolger ThieleThomas Stiermaier
Published in: European heart journal (2024)
Bailout GP IIb/IIIa inhibition in AMI patients with angiographic MVO failed to reduce the primary endpoint infarct size but decreased CMR-derived MVO and led to an increase in non-fatal bleeding events.
